forum.gl-inet.cn

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
热搜: 活动 交友 discuz
    查看: 45495|回复: 121

    [02-03更新] 怎样用Action编译openwrt插件

      [复制链接]

    76

    主题

    2144

    帖子

    9846

    积分

    管理员

    Rank: 9Rank: 9Rank: 9

    积分
    9846

    官方人员

    发表于 2022-7-29 15:31:58 | 显示全部楼层 |阅读模式
    为了帮助大家编译插件,我做了一个基于github action的插件库,可以帮助大家自动编译出需要的插件
    当前支持型号:
    AX1800
    AXT1800
    MT2500
    MT3000
    SF1200
    SFT1200

    前置条件:
    1. 自己必须注册github账号
    2. github账号需使能action,action使能请参考github官方文档

    Action仓库链接:
    https://github.com/luochongjun/gl-sdk-action

    使用教程:
    1. fork我的x项目到自己仓库



    2. fork之后会自动切到自己的仓库
       . 切到Action页面
       . 选择set_variable 工作流
       . 点击run workflow按钮   . 选择需要编译的目标设备
       . 在下拉输入框source code URL中填入需要编译的插件源码地址(注意使用https,不要使用ssh, 例:https://github.com/luochongjun/edgerouter.git
       . 在下拉输入框Openwrt package name中填入需要编译的插件名 (要编译的插件名字,例:edgerouter)
       .  如果源代码需要认证信息可以输入邮箱和密码,如果没有则留空
       . 点击Run workflow


    3. 接下来会自动执行编译,编译时间快的可能2,3分钟,取决于插件本身的编译时间


    4. 编译完成后,点击对应工作,可查看编译好的插件压缩包,压缩包中包含了你需要编译的插件以及所有依赖软件包

    下载解压后找到需要的ipk文件


    5. 将ipk文件传到路由器后台,使用opkg命令安装.
    更新记录
    2022-11-18更新:支持MT2500
    2023-02-03更新:支持MT3000,AX1800








    本帖子中包含更多资源

    您需要 登录 才可以下载或查看,没有帐号?立即注册

    x
    回复

    使用道具 举报

    8

    主题

    48

    帖子

    502

    积分

    高级会员

    Rank: 4

    积分
    502
    发表于 2022-7-29 15:47:59 | 显示全部楼层
    AXT用户支持。
    回复

    使用道具 举报

    4

    主题

    41

    帖子

    1296

    积分

    金牌会员

    Rank: 6Rank: 6

    积分
    1296
    发表于 2022-7-29 15:58:04 | 显示全部楼层
    支持支持
    回复

    使用道具 举报

    3

    主题

    46

    帖子

    375

    积分

    中级会员

    Rank: 3Rank: 3

    积分
    375
    发表于 2022-7-29 18:42:56 | 显示全部楼层
    感谢萝卜大侠,经测试成功编译aliyundrive-webdav插件,
    总算是实现了SFT1200插件自由了,真不容易啊!
    再次万分感谢萝卜大侠的辛勤付出。
    回复

    使用道具 举报

    3

    主题

    46

    帖子

    375

    积分

    中级会员

    Rank: 3Rank: 3

    积分
    375
    发表于 2022-7-29 19:10:17 | 显示全部楼层
    memory 发表于 2022-7-29 16:36
    大佬,小白一名,请问怎么第五步,将ipk文件传到路由器后台,使用opkg命令安装.怎么实现,还有就是在哪找这 ...

    1.启动HFS(HTTP文件服务器),将相关IPK拉入HFS。
    2.SSH至SFT1200,使用wget命令下载HFS里的IPK文件。
    3.使用opkg install命令安装下载的ipk文件。
    回复

    使用道具 举报

    1

    主题

    3

    帖子

    25

    积分

    新手上路

    Rank: 1

    积分
    25
    发表于 2022-7-29 21:16:42 | 显示全部楼层
    turbo acc一直不能启动一个关键加速。现在30M的解码能力,有他估计能提升到40多M网飞4K齐活了
    回复

    使用道具 举报

    76

    主题

    2144

    帖子

    9846

    积分

    管理员

    Rank: 9Rank: 9Rank: 9

    积分
    9846

    官方人员

     楼主| 发表于 2022-7-29 21:43:14 | 显示全部楼层
    chaosrb79 发表于 2022-7-29 21:16
    turbo acc一直不能启动一个关键加速。现在30M的解码能力,有他估计能提升到40多M网飞4K齐活了 ...

    SF1200有点勉强
    回复

    使用道具 举报

    76

    主题

    2144

    帖子

    9846

    积分

    管理员

    Rank: 9Rank: 9Rank: 9

    积分
    9846

    官方人员

     楼主| 发表于 2022-7-29 21:43:55 | 显示全部楼层
    xiamiwolf 发表于 2022-7-29 18:42
    感谢萝卜大侠,经测试成功编译aliyundrive-webdav插件,
    总算是实现了SFT1200插件自由了,真不容易啊!
    再 ...

    小事小事
    回复

    使用道具 举报

    76

    主题

    2144

    帖子

    9846

    积分

    管理员

    Rank: 9Rank: 9Rank: 9

    积分
    9846

    官方人员

     楼主| 发表于 2022-7-29 21:45:18 | 显示全部楼层
    xiamiwolf 发表于 2022-7-29 19:10
    1.启动HFS(HTTP文件服务器),将相关IPK拉入HFS。
    2.SSH至SFT1200,使用wget命令下载HFS里的IPK文件。
    3. ...

    感谢分享
    回复

    使用道具 举报

    9

    主题

    41

    帖子

    201

    积分

    中级会员

    Rank: 3Rank: 3

    积分
    201
    发表于 2022-8-1 14:40:21 | 显示全部楼层
    求视频,实在看不懂
    回复

    使用道具 举报

    您需要登录后才可以回帖 登录 | 立即注册

    本版积分规则

    Archiver|手机版|小黑屋|gl-inet.cn ( 粤ICP备18130956号 )

    GMT+8, 2024-11-21 17:32 , Processed in 0.021652 second(s), 26 queries .

    Powered by Discuz! X3.4

    Copyright © 2001-2021, Tencent Cloud.

    快速回复 返回顶部 返回列表